TGF-beta expression in the human colon: differential immunostaining along crypt epithelium.

Abstract

Samples of colorectal carcinoma, adenoma and normal colorectal mucosa were examined for the expression of TGF-beta by immunohistochemistry. Immunoreactivity for TGF-beta was present in 52 out of a total of 58 samples of normal mucosa examined. In adenomas and carcinomas TGF-beta expression was observed in eight out of ten and 46 out of 48 samples respectively and was largely restricted to epithelial cells. In normal mucosa differential expression of TGF-beta was present within epithelial cells, those in the upper parts of the crypts showing enhanced immunoreactivity compared to cells in the proliferative compartment. This pattern of differential staining is consistent with TGF-beta having an important role in the control of growth and differentiation in colonic mucosa.

摘要

采用免疫组织化学方法检测结直肠癌、腺瘤及正常结直肠黏膜样本中转化生长因子β(TGF-β)的表达。在所检测的58份正常黏膜样本中,52份存在TGF-β免疫反应性。在腺瘤和癌组织中,分别在10份样本中的8份以及48份样本中的46份观察到TGF-β表达,且主要局限于上皮细胞。在正常黏膜中,上皮细胞内存在TGF-β的差异表达,与增殖区的细胞相比,隐窝上部的细胞显示出增强的免疫反应性。这种差异染色模式与TGF-β在结肠黏膜生长和分化控制中起重要作用一致。
